PROBLEM Too many tanks!

You have too many big tanks. Usually, one is enough. Tanks are costly and you can hardly have two of them at the same time in the arena. Consider keeping only one of these:

Warning No way to deal with the opponent's pump!

When your opponent plays Elixir collector, you have to be able to react accordingly or you're letting him accumulate elixir and then use it against you.

Some cards can be both level-independent and weak/strong when under/overleveled. Example: A lower-level Ice Golem doesn't kill Skarmy, so it's 'Weak'. However, in other aspects such as tanking, it works perfectly fine on lower levels.
